- tinc is looking for /dev/net/tun while my phone only has /dev/tun (might
be device specific? symlink or configuration directive fixes this)
I personnaly use the "Device=/dev/tun" from the configuration file to
specify which file to use.
Thanks, that works too. I don't know if it makes sense to change the default for android builds?
- config file selection shows empty list for /data because /data is chmod
771 by default, perhaps you can work around this by reading the directory as
root?
Would be quite a pain, as I would have to parse command line results
to browse directories (as you can only start sub-processes with root
right, not get them on the main process).
Anyway I advise using a folder in /sdcard, so you can update it easily
from your computer.
I see. I tried to use /sdcard first, but I couldn't set the permissions necessary to execute the tinc-up script (to configure the interface), so that didn't work for me. I changed the permissions on /data to be world readable.

Hi Adam,

As for tinc on linux, you'll need a TUN/TAP device on android as well
(my app is just a basic GUI over the standard tinc daemon). I'm not
sure it's available on every ROM. I use CM9/10 on a SGS2, and the
driver is included in the kernel.
Same, you can disable root usage in the application (in the settings),
but it's probably needed to access the TUN/TAP device anyway...

The GUI is minimalistic, and is mainly used to deploy the tincd binary
and launch/monitor it easily.
For the configuration, the easiest solution is to build it from a PC
and copy it to your phone's SD card.
This might not be easy enough for the average android user, however I
guess tinc's user are more in the geek category :)

As I was missing an Android port of tinc (thanks for this great
tool!), I built one by myself.
It's simply a cross-compiled version of tinc daemon (with very few
changes), and a (basic) GUI application for Android to deploy and
manage it.

Both my changes to original tinc and the GUI are available on GitHub:
- https://github.com/Vilbrekin/tinc
- https://github.com/Vilbrekin/tinc_gui

The tinc GUI is available on Google Play as well:

https://play.google.com/store/apps/details?id=org.poirsouille.tinc_gui&feature=search_result#?t=W251bGwsMSwyLDEsIm9yZy5wb2lyc291aWxsZS50aW5jX2d1aSJd


My changes to original tinc being minimal (added ifdef for 2 missing
functions on Android NDK, and a new configuration file option), I was
thinking of merging them with upstream. Are you accepting pull
requests?
